CVE-2026-11884

Опубликовано: 04 июн. 2026
Источник: redhat
CVSS3: 6.5

Описание

A heap buffer overflow flaw was found in 389 Directory Server. When serializing objectclass definitions, the oc_superior (SUP) field length is omitted from buffer size calculations in read_schema_dse() and schema_oc_to_string(), but the field is still written via strcat(). An attacker with Directory Manager privileges, or a compromised replication supplier, can trigger a server crash by creating objectclasses with long SUP values. This is an incomplete fix variant of CVE-2025-14905.

Отчет

Red Hat rates this issue as Moderate impact. When serializing objectclass definitions in 389-ds-base, the oc_superior (SUP) field length is omitted from buffer size calculations in read_schema_dse() and schema_oc_to_string(), but the field is still written—an incomplete fix variant of CVE-2025-14905. Directory Manager can crash the server with long SUP values; a compromised replication supplier may push malicious schema to consumers.

Меры по смягчению последствий

Restrict Directory Manager access. Audit replication agreements. Monitor cn=schema modifications for unusually long SUP values. Restrict LDAP replication traffic to trusted networks.
